Sadržaj:

Wordpress u džepu: 6 koraka
Wordpress u džepu: 6 koraka

Video: Wordpress u džepu: 6 koraka

Video: Wordpress u džepu: 6 koraka
Video: Коммитим в ядро WordPress №6 2024, Novembar
Anonim
Wordpress u džepu
Wordpress u džepu

Raspberry Pi Zero je najmanji računar u porodici Raspberry Pi.

Lako se stavlja u džep, Pi Zero se može koristiti kao Wordpress server.

Odabrao sam Wordpress jer je to trenutno rješenje za jednostavno stvaranje moćne web stranice.

Korak 1: Potrebne stvari

Potrebne stvari
Potrebne stvari
Potrebne stvari
Potrebne stvari
Potrebne stvari
Potrebne stvari

1 Raspberry Pi Zero ili Zero W spojen na Internet. Uverite se da koristite operativni sistem zasnovan na Debianu, kao što su Raspbian ili DietPi. Ubuntu nije podržan na Pi Zero, jer Ubuntu može raditi samo na ARMv7 ili novijoj arhitekturi. Ovdje sam postavio Pi Zero putem USB Etherneta. To možete učiniti i putem Wi-Fi-ja.

Provjerite je li SSH omogućen.

2 Stoni računar sa internetskom vezom.

3 Softver terminala za kit (ako koristite Windows). Link:-

Ako koristite Mac ili Linux računalo, otvorite terminal i upotrijebite naredbu "ssh".

Korak 2: Povezivanje

Povezivanje
Povezivanje
Povezivanje
Povezivanje
Povezivanje
Povezivanje

Uključite Zero i povežite ga s internetom koristeći Wifi ili USB Ethernet.

Saznajte IP adresu vašeg Pi Zero -a prijavljivanjem na usmjerivač. Obično https://192.168.1.1 ili

Adresa stranice za prilagođavanje usmjerivača različita je za različite usmjerivače. IP adresu možete pronaći na naljepnici na stražnjoj strani usmjerivača. Ili pronađite IP adresu vašeg usmjerivača na Googleu.

Također možete koristiti Appleovu uslugu Bonjour koja podržava Multicast DNS (ili naziv hosta, poput raspberrypi.local)

Bonjour možete preuzeti ovdje:-

Ovo olakšava stvari. Možete koristiti svoje ime hosta za prijavljivanje na svoj Pi Zero putem SSH -a umjesto da saznate njegov IP, a zatim ga upišete.

Možete koristiti i alat kao što je Advanced IP Scanner. Preuzmite ga ovdje:-

ili upotrijebite Angry IP Scanner. Preuzmite ga ovdje:-

Sada unesite IP adresu u postavke prijave za Putty i prijavite se na svoj Pi Zero kao pi korisnik.

Sada ćete moći daljinski pristupiti Pi naredbenom retku. Nakon što se prijavite, trebali biste vidjeti:-

pi@raspberrypi ~ $:

Ako i dalje ne znate kako omogućiti ssh, spojite tastaturu i miš monitora na svoj Pi Zero.

Otvorite terminal i upišite:-

sudo raspi-config

Ovo otvara alat za konfiguraciju.

Ako koristite Raspbian Stretch:-

odaberite Interfaceing Options, pritisnite enter.

Pitat će vas želite li omogućiti ssh server.

Odaberite da.

Ali ako koristite Raspbian Jessie:-

odaberite Napredne opcije, pritisnite enter i učinite isto što je gore navedeno.

Izađite iz alata raspi-config

Sada biste trebali ponovo pokrenuti Pi upisivanjem:-

sudo reboot

Ponovno pokretanje nakon konfiguracije osigurava da učinak promjena ima učinak.

Sada koristite ssh terminal na svom normalnom desktop računaru. Ako koristite Windows, Putty, ako koristite Linux ili Mac, upišite naredbu 'ssh' u svoj terminal.

Zadano korisničko ime je pi

Zadana lozinka je malina.

Svi su napisani malim slovima.

Svoju lozinku možete promijeniti, ako želite, upisivanjem:-

sudo passwd

Korak 3: Naredbe koje treba pokrenuti na terminalu

Naredbe koje treba pokrenuti na terminalu
Naredbe koje treba pokrenuti na terminalu
Naredbe koje treba pokrenuti na terminalu
Naredbe koje treba pokrenuti na terminalu
Naredbe koje treba pokrenuti na terminalu
Naredbe koje treba pokrenuti na terminalu

Pokreni (upišite sljedeće u svoj terminal):-

sudo apt-get update

sudo apt -get upgrade -y

Zatim ponovno pokrenite Pi Zero upisivanjem:-

sudo reboot

Ponovno pokretanje je potrebno kako bi nove promjene povezane s jezgrom stupile na snagu.

sudo apt-get install -y apache2 php libapache2-mod-php mysql-server php-mysql

NAPOMENA:- VAŽNO! MOLIMO VAS PROMENITE php u php5 libapache2-mod-php5 php5-mysql AKO KORISTITE RASPBIAN JESSIE!

sudo servis apache2 ponovno pokretanje

ili

sudo /etc/init.d/apache2 ponovno pokretanje

Sada promijenite direktorij upisivanjem:-

cd/var/www/html

Ovo je zadani direktorij Apache2 u koji možete pisati HTML programe ili druge programe koji se odnose na dizajniranje weba, poput.css,.php,.js

Pokrenite sljedeće da biste instalirali wordpress i dali sebi vlasništvo nad tim direktorijem:-

sudo rm *

sudo wget

sudo tar xzf latest.tar.gz

sudo mv wordpress/*.

sudo rm -rf wordpress latest.tar.gz

sudo chown -R www -data:.

Na posljednjoj slici ponovo sam pokrenuo uslugu Apache2 nakon što sam učinio potrebne stvari u/var/www/html direktoriju (poput instalacije wordpress -a)

Korak 4: Postavljanje baze podataka za Wordpress

Postavljanje baze podataka za Wordpress
Postavljanje baze podataka za Wordpress
Postavljanje baze podataka za Wordpress
Postavljanje baze podataka za Wordpress
Postavljanje baze podataka za Wordpress
Postavljanje baze podataka za Wordpress

Pokrenite ovu naredbu:-

sudo mysql_secure_installation

Od vas će se tražiti da unesete trenutnu lozinku za root (unesite ako nema): - pritisnite Enter.

Upišite Y i pritisnite Enter za postavljanje root lozinke ?.

Unesite lozinku u odzivnik Nova lozinka: i pritisnite Enter

NAPOMENA:- JAKO VAŽNO! ZAPIŠTITE LOZINKU KOJU SADA UNOSITE, KAKO ĆE VAM BITI POTREBNIJI.

Upišite Y do:-

Uklonite anonimne korisnike, Onemogućite root prijavljivanje na daljinu, Uklonite testnu bazu podataka i pristup njoj, Odmah učitajte tablice privilegija.

Kada završite, vidjet ćete poruku Sve je gotovo! i hvala što koristite MariaDB !.

Sada ćete biti dočekani uobičajenom komandnom linijom:- pi@raspberrypi ~ $:

Upišite ovu naredbu:-

sudo mysql -uroot -p

Zatim unesite lozinku koju ste unijeli ranije.

Sada ćete biti dočekani MariaDB upitom (ovako>).

Unesite ovu naredbu za kreiranje baze podataka namd wordpress.

kreiranje baze podataka wordpress;

Zapamtite, točka -zarez na kraju naredbe važna je u SQL sintaksi.

Sada pokrenite ovu naredbu:-

ODOBRITE SVE PRIVILEGIJE NA wordpress -u.* TO 'root'@'localhost' IDENTIFICIRANO 'YOURPASSWORD';

Zamijenite YOURPASSWORD lozinkom koju ste ranije unijeli.

Zatim pokrenite:-

FLUSH PRIVILEGES;

Zatim pritisnite ctrl + d za izlaz.

Korak 5: Skoro smo stigli

Skoro sam tu
Skoro sam tu
Skoro sam tu
Skoro sam tu
Skoro sam tu
Skoro sam tu

Sada otvorite preglednik i upišite IP adresu Pi Zero. Odaberite jezik i kliknite Nastavi. Biće vam prikazan WordPress ekran. Sada kliknite Let's Go dugme na stranici. Unesite korisničko ime kao root i lozinku kao lozinku koju ste ranije unijeli. Pokrenite dugme Install. Dajte vašoj web stranici privlačan naslov i root korisničko ime. Sve završeno!

Sada samo nekoliko završnih detalja:-

sudo a2enmod prepisati

sudo nano /etc/apache2/sites-available/000-default.conf

Dodajte ove redove u datoteku nakon retka 1:- AllowOverride All

Uverite se da je unutar.

To bi trebalo izgledati otprilike ovako:-

AllowOverride All

Slike prikazuju korak po korak instalaciju Wordpress -a. Posljednja četiri pokazuju posljednje detalje. Zatim pokrenite:-

sudo servis apache2 ponovno pokretanje

Za ponovno pokretanje usluge Apache2.

Korak 6: Vaša vlastita web stranica

Vaša vlastita web stranica
Vaša vlastita web stranica
Vaša vlastita web stranica
Vaša vlastita web stranica
Vaša vlastita web stranica
Vaša vlastita web stranica

Na posljednjoj slici je moja probna web stranica, koju sam prilagodio na stranici Prilagođavanje prikazanoj na prethodnoj slici. Možete se prijaviti (slika 1) i prilagoditi svoju stranicu, lako dodati teme, fontove i sve to na svoju web stranicu (slika 2). Također možete instalirati nove teme. NAPOMENA:- Nisam proslijedio svoj Raspberry Pi Zero putem porta, pa nećete moći pregledati moju web stranicu osim ako se ne povežete na istu mrežu koju koristim (tj. Moj kućni usmjerivač)

Nadam se da ste uživali u izradi vlastitog džepnog Wordpress servera koristeći Raspberry Pi Zero ili Zero W.

Zbogom i sretno dizajniranje weba!:):):):)

Preporučuje se: